Detailed Solution

The presence of −OH groups in a compound leads to Hydrogen-bonding, which greatly increases its boiling point. Generally, the more 'exposed' the −OH group, the better it can participate in intermolecular H-bonding and thus, the boiling point will elevate. By that logic, primary alcohols will have the highest boiling point, while tertiary alcohols will have the lowest boiling point.

1 alcohol >2 alcohol >3 alcohol
